Description

In the broken reality of the Aether, Earth, the once vibrant cradle of life, is nothing but a scar in the void and a quickly-fading memory to the far reaches of the universe. The last two humans in existence, Cray and Jupiter Blackmoor, narrowly avoid annihilation as a natural force beyond human comprehension tears the planet asunder.

Now burdened with the weight of losing everything they have ever known, Cray and Jupiter find salvation deep in the Andromeda galaxy. They are warmly welcomed on Grand Atelier, a breathtaking terra adorned with majestic castles and awe-inspiring creatures. Guardians of timeless wisdom offer guidance, and embodiments of instinctual chaos bring forth strength.

But, Earth's demise reverberates through civilizations, and an enigmatic organization, bound by an ancient oath to safeguard all intelligent life, sets in motion a sinister plan to lay claim over what they demand is theirs. Cray and Jupiter's very existence becomes a catalyst for an unprecedented clash between opposing forces, threatening not only their own lives but perhaps the fate of all existence.

Exsomnis, translated to Wakeful in Latin, is the first book in the Primus Tenebrae series. It explores the depths of human resilience in the face of absolute devastation. Amidst the remnants of a shattered future, Cray and Jupiter must confront their own frailties and rediscover the embers of hope. They must rise from the ashes or succumb to the darkness that threatens to engulf them. Earth's tragic end is but the prelude to a confrontation that will forever alter space and time.
